Open a new card ... WebA co-signer takes on all the rights and responsibilities of a loan along with the borrower. This means that if the borrower can't make a payment on the loan, the co-signer is responsible. Cosigning a loan can also affect the credit score of the co-signer for better or for worse. WebLet your potential cosigner know why you need their help. Be honest with them and inform them that you don't have the credit you need to obtain favorable financing. Make their responsibility perfectly clear. Inform your potential cosigner that they'll have to repay your loan if you can't or don't make your payments for any reason.
